Output 06898c363c31e4f14f32e342329581a9fde313c45f7791c3e7aade94f3115ee6:12

value
50146448
script pubkey
OP_0 OP_PUSHBYTES_20 a5a3163d3770f21bc1926d5472cbd05e59cc22fa
address
bc1q5k33v0fhwrephsvjd4289j7stevucgh65vksxu
transaction
06898c363c31e4f14f32e342329581a9fde313c45f7791c3e7aade94f3115ee6
spent
true